Episode 466 was broadcast on 11 November 1986, as part of Series 10.

Harvey Freeman played Roy James, with Harvey Freeman winning 75 – 10. The Dictionary Corner guest was Bill Tidy, and the lexicographer was Freda Thornton.

Freeman's 75 points is the joint-highest 9-round score ever achieved without a nine-letter word. This record is shared by Richard Campbell (Episode 1504). Freeman's performance was also a Jos game, since he was beaten only by the unspotted word LUTEOUS.
